SoundHound (SOUNW) stock outlook | analyst sentiment and price action remain in focus. SoundHound AI Inc. Warrant (SOUNW) closed at $2.48, reflecting a modest decline of 0.64% on the trading day. The warrant is currently trading above its identified support level of $2.36, while facing near-term resistance near $2.6. The price action suggests a period of consolidation within a tight range.
